1.1. Defining Average and Median Income

What’s the difference between average and median income, and why does it matter? The average income is the total income divided by the number of income earners, while the median income is the midpoint of incomes, with half earning more and half earning less. The median is generally considered a more accurate representation of typical income because it’s less affected by extremely high or low incomes. In Australia, the median income provides a more realistic view of what a typical worker earns, as highlighted in reports from the Australian Tax Office. Understanding both figures gives a more comprehensive view of income distribution and economic equality.

1.2. Current Average Income Statistics in Australia

What are the latest average income figures in Australia for 2024? For 2024, the average annual income in Australia is approximately AUD 91,200 (USD 60,185), while the median annual income is around AUD 80,100 (USD 52,866). These figures, sourced from recent data by Salaryexplorer.com and the Australian Bureau of Statistics, reflect the gross income before taxes and deductions. These statistics provide a benchmark for understanding typical income levels and can be used to assess your earning potential in different industries and locations.

1.3. How Does Australia Compare Globally?

How does the average income in Australia compare to other developed countries? While Australia’s average income is competitive, it generally sits lower than that of the United States and some European countries like Switzerland and Norway. However, Australia often ranks high in terms of quality of life, which can offset the income difference. According to a study by the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D), Australia performs well in areas such as health, education, and environmental quality, which are important considerations when evaluating overall well-being. This makes Australia an attractive place to live and work, even if the average income isn’t the highest globally.

2.4. Geographical Location: City vs. Rural Income

How does location impact average income in Australia? Geographical location has a significant impact on average income in Australia, with major cities like Sydney and Melbourne generally offering higher salaries than rural areas. The higher cost of living in these cities often necessitates higher wages to attract and retain talent. Additionally, certain states and territories, such as Western Australia and the Australian Capital Territory, tend to have higher average incomes due to their concentration of high-paying industries like mining and government services. Considering location is essential when evaluating job opportunities and negotiating salary expectations.

4.1. Mining Industry: Opportunities and Salaries

What are the opportunities and salary prospects in the mining industry in Australia? The mining industry in Australia offers lucrative opportunities and high salaries, driven by the country’s abundant natural resources and global demand for commodities. Roles in mining engineering, geology, and resource management are particularly well-compensated, with average salaries often exceeding AUD 150,000 per year. While the mining industry can be cyclical, it continues to be a significant contributor to the Australian economy, providing stable employment and attractive financial rewards. Information from the Minerals Council of Australia provides insights into industry trends and employment opportunities.

5.5. Visa and Immigration Information for Foreign Workers

What visa and immigration options are available for foreign workers seeking employment in Australia? Foreign workers seeking employment in Australia have several visa and immigration options available, depending on their skills, qualifications, and the needs of the Australian economy. The Skilled Independent visa, Employer Nomination Scheme, and Temporary Skill Shortage visa are popular options for skilled workers. The Department of Home Affairs provides detailed information on visa requirements, application processes, and eligibility criteria. Consulting with an immigration lawyer or migration agent can help you navigate the visa application process effectively.

6.1. Types of Income-Boosting Partnerships

What types of partnerships can lead to increased income in Australia? Various types of partnerships can lead to increased income in Australia, including joint ventures, strategic alliances, referral partnerships, and affiliate marketing. Joint ventures involve pooling resources and expertise to undertake a specific project, while strategic alliances focus on long-term collaboration to achieve mutual goals. Referral partnerships involve recommending each other’s services to clients, while affiliate marketing involves earning commissions by promoting other businesses’ products or services. Each type of partnership offers unique benefits and opportunities for income growth.
